Graeme Souness has emerged as a contender for the vacant Crystal Palace manager's job.
The Eagles are in the hunt for a new boss after Iain Dowie left by mutual consent on Monday.
Souness is keen to get back into work after getting sacked by Newcastle United in February.
And he will meet with Palace chairman Simon Jordan when he returns from holiday next week.
"I have a lot of time for Simon Jordan and what he is doing at Crystal Palace. We get on," said Souness.
"It is certainly something I would be interested in. I'm ready for another challenge and Palace is something that appeals should it arise."
